    Then LaPread left in 1986 and moved to Auckland, New Zealand. Reynolds departed for Earth, Wind & Fire in 1987, which prompted trumpeter William "WAK" King to take over primary guitar duties for live performances.

  5. 8 de jul. de 2017 · When Ronald LaPread came home to Tuskegee recently, he was so warm and gracious it was instantly clear that his legendary status has not changed him. As the bass player for The Commodores, his creative energy produced those opening licks on “Brickhouse,” an R&B classic that was released in 1977, exactly 40 years ago.
